Course Details
β’ Major Authors and Their Works: Lu Xun, Eileen Chang, and Mo Yan
β’ Themes and Motifs in Modern Chinese Literature: Identity, Revolution, and Tradition
β’ Literary Criticism and Theory in Chinese Contexts
β’ Comparative Analysis: Modern Chinese Literature and Global Literary Trends
β’ Gender and Society in Modern Chinese Fiction
β’ The Role of Translation in Disseminating Chinese Literature
β’ Contemporary Chinese Literature: Post-Mao Era to the Present
β’ The Intersection of Politics and Literature in Modern China
β’ Research Methodologies for Studying Modern Chinese Literature
